OPP Release Details of Late March Drug Bust at a Marijuana Grow Op https://www.mykemptvillenow.com/23290/news/opp-release-details-of-late-march-drug-bust-at-a-marijuana-grow-op/ Tue, 17 Apr 2018 12:17:06 +0000 http://www.mykemptvillenow.com/?p=23290

The OPP has released details about a drug bust late last month.

On March 21st Stormont Dundas and Glengarry OPP officers and members of the Community Street Crime Unit Emergency Response team executed a Controlled Drugs and Substance Search warrant in South Dundas. As a result police seized over $300,000 in marijuana and cannabis by-products.
According to the OPP 140 pounds of cannabis, 336 grams of marijuana bud, 84 cloned marijuana plants, 9 marijuana plants, hash cannabis resin and oil, and methamphetamine were all seized. A man and woman were arrested in connection to the warrant. Both are facing a number of charges including possession of a controlled substance, production of a controlled substance and property obtained by crime.

They are due in Morrisburg court on May 1st.

Rideau Canals InfoNet Now Available on Parks Canada’s Website https://www.mykemptvillenow.com/23274/news/rideau-canals-infonet-now-available-on-parks-canadas-website/ Mon, 16 Apr 2018 11:10:03 +0000 http://www.mykemptvillenow.com/?p=23274

Residents looking for more information about water levels on the Rideau Canal have a new tool.

Parks Canada has launched the Ontario Waterways Water Management InfoNet on the Rideau Canal website. The InfoNet includes a water levels tool that shows details about the water level of lakes for the last 30 days and a graphic showing the current year.

There is also background information on water management practices and updates, a frequently asked questions section and reports about water management. Parks Canada stresses this information is not meant for flood forecasting and encourage stakeholders to continuing contacting the Conservation Authority.

The Region’s Largest Business Retention and Expansion Program Has Grown https://www.mykemptvillenow.com/23223/uncategorized/the-regions-largest-business-retention-and-expansion-program-has-grown/ Fri, 13 Apr 2018 12:13:36 +0000 http://www.mykemptvillenow.com/?p=23223

The biggest Business Retention and Expansion program in the region’s history just got a little bit larger.

Economic Development Manager with the United Counties of Leeds and Grenville Ann Weir says earlier this week the communities of Augusta, Merrickville-Wolford and Rideau Lakes launched BR+E programs. According to Weir all three communities will be working with the United Counties to create four surveys, one from each community and one from the counties.

Business Retention Officer with the United Counties Krista George says their goal is to assist businesses that are already heavily invested in the community to flourish and expand. Businesses will be contacted and asked to complete a survey about their concerns and needs; these results will then be reviewed so local governments have a better understanding of what enterprise in the area needs. Weir says they want to be sure businesses in the area can grow while remaining in our community.

According to Weir they are planning to contact over 300 businesses right now but interested parties are encouraged to reach out and ask to be surveyed. Kemptville’s Second Pop Up Shop has Opened in the Old Town https://www.mykemptvillenow.com/23213/news/kemptvilles-second-pop-up-shop-has-opened-in-the-old-town/ Thu, 12 Apr 2018 11:54:13 +0000 http://www.mykemptvillenow.com/?p=23213

The Pop-Up Shop trend continues in downtown Kemptville.

Compassionate Support for Stressful Times is the second business to receive support from the Old Town Kemptville Business Improvement Area through the Pop-Up Shop Program. Shulamit Ber Levtov is moving her business to Prescott Street and taking advantage of a push to return business to downtown Kemptville.

Old Town BIA Executive Director John Barclay says there has been a significant revival over the last year and half, with the amount of commercial real estate available shrinking. Businesses interested in the program can get up to five months’ rent in a commercial space for half the market value, marketing support and mentorship from local entrepreneurs.

Ideas like pop-up shops can bring building owners and those looking to launch businesses together according to Old Town BIA Chair Deb Wilson. She thinks it may actually be more worthwhile because the partnership is with local businesses who are invested in the downtown’s future.
